Intel processors target comm and storage

The Intel processor code named Jasper Forest cuts 27 W off the system power needed by the previous generation. Based on the Nehelam CPU, the one-, two-, and four-core processor targets embedded communications and storage applications and feature on chip PCIe Gen 2.0 I/O,

The low-power 45-nm IC also adds hardware RAID acceleration on chip. Available by early 2010, the device will be offered with 7-year lifecycle support. Single-core versions will take 23 to 30 W, dual-core 35 to 65 W, and quad-core 48 to 85 W. All use the same socket. (Price not set yet — available 1st qtr 2010.)
